BBA Aviation Expects Growth In 2016 As 2015 Profit Falls

Thu, 03rd Mar 2016 08:07

LONDON (Alliance News) - BBA Aviation PLC Thursday said it expects further good growth in 2016 and beyond, as it reported a fall in pretax profit for 2014, hit by exceptional costs and lower fuel prices and foreign exchange movements reducing revenue.

BBA Aviation provides aviation support and aftermaket services.

The company reported a pretax profit of USD95.3 million, down from USD152.4 million in 2014, as revenue declined to USD2.13 billion from USD2.29 billion, compounded by USD15.1 million in restructuring costs and USD44.4 million in exceptional costs.

These exceptional costs included USD38.4 million of transaction costs related to its acquisition of Landmark Aviation.

BBA Aviation attributed its decline in revenue to a hit from lower fuel prices and foreign exchange movements, which it estimated reduced revenue by USD248.5 million. Overall it delivered a "satisfactory" performance in the year, with above market growth in its flight support segment driven by its Signature business offsetting a "disappointing" year for its aftermarket services.

It proposed a final dividend of 8.68 cents per share, taking its total dividend to 13.53 cents, down from 16.20 cents in the previous year. The company said that, after adjusting for the impact of a rights issue it undertook to partly fund its acquisition of Landmark Aviation, its final dividend would have been 12.15 cents, giving it a total dividend of 17.00 cents for the year.

"We anticipate further progress in 2016, driven mainly by Signature's continued outperformance, the application of its operational excellence across a much larger network of high quality locations and the realisation of the Signature/Landmark combination benefits which enhance the group's prospects for cash generation and value creation. The board therefore expects further good growth in 2016 and beyond," said Chief Executive Officer Simon Pryce in a statement.

BBA shares were up 2.0% to 194.3p early Thursday.
